    What to Expect During Your Visit

    Knowing what to expect during your visit to Isanti County Jail can significantly ease any anxiety and help you prepare mentally for the experience. First off, expect a thorough security screening. Before you're allowed to enter the visiting area, you'll likely have to go through a metal detector and possibly a pat-down. This is standard procedure to ensure that no contraband enters the facility. You'll also need to present your identification to verify your identity. Once you're cleared, you'll be directed to the visiting area, which is typically a large room with tables and chairs. The inmates will be brought in from their housing units and allowed to sit with their visitors. Keep in mind that the visiting area is usually monitored by correctional officers, so it's important to conduct yourself appropriately and follow all the rules. Physical contact with inmates is often restricted, so avoid any behavior that could be seen as inappropriate or disruptive. During your visit, you can expect to have a conversation with the inmate, but keep in mind that the topics you discuss might be monitored. Avoid talking about anything that could jeopardize the inmate's safety or the security of the facility. The length of your visit will depend on the jail's policies and the inmate's privileges. Be sure to check the visiting hours beforehand so you know how much time you'll have. When the visit is over, you'll be asked to leave the visiting area and return to the lobby. The inmates will be escorted back to their housing units. By knowing what to expect during your visit, you can help ensure a smooth and stress-free experience.
